I cannot understand how to perform the calibration using the parameters:

#define AZIMUTH_CALIBRATION_FROM_ARRAY {180,630}
#define AZIMUTH_CALIBRATION_TO_ARRAY {180,630}

I need these parameters because my rotor has no linear variation, so I would like to create more measurement points to make the AZ reading accurate.

With the debub I can read the "Analog" value and therefore I am able to attribute the right "Analog" value to each position.
In my case Analog is between 3 and 517 (3 = position -180 and 517 +180 with central North).
I could not find explanations regarding the values indicated, I only understood that I have to create multiple FROM_TO but it is not clear to me how to enter the parameters inside.
You can give me an example with:

Position AZ 90 ° = Analog 300
Position AZ 270 = Analog 175
Position AZ 180 = Analog 225

(for example)

The limit switches are perfect (CCW and CW) made via the terminal.

#define AZIMUTH_CALIBRATION_FROM_ARRAY
{ 0, 44, 90, 179, 226, 271, 316, 329, 362, 450 } /* GRADI CHE SI LEGGONO SOTTO----these are in "raw" degrees, i.e. when going east past 360 degrees, add 360 degrees*/

#define AZIMUTH_CALIBRATION_TO_ARRAY
{ 0, 45, 90, 180, 225, 270, 315, 330, 360, 448 } /* GRADI REALI
